-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athkeycloak.env
36 lines (30 loc) · 910 Bytes
/
keycloak.env
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# Keycloak Admin Credentials
KC_BOOTSTRAP_ADMIN_USERNAME=admin
KC_BOOTSTRAP_ADMIN_PASSWORD=admin
# Keycloak Development and Backup Settings
KEYCLOAK_DEV_MODE=true
KEYCLOAK_STARTUP_IMPORT=false
KEYCLOAK_BACKUP_RESTORE=false
KEYCLOAK_BACKUP_ON_SIGTERM=false
# Keycloak HTTP and Hostname Settings
KC_HTTP_ENABLED=true
KC_HOSTNAME_STRICT=false
KC_HOSTNAME_STRICT_HTTPS=false
KC_HOSTNAME=localhost
#KC_PROXY=edge
# Database Configuration
KC_DB=mysql
KC_DB_URL_HOST=mysql
KC_DB_URL_PORT=3306
KC_DB_SCHEMA=keycloak
KC_DB_USERNAME=keycloak
KC_DB_PASSWORD=keycloak
KC_DB_URL_DATABASE=keycloak
MYSQL_DATABASE:${KC_DB_URL_DATABASE}
MYSQL_USER:${KC_DB_USERNAME}
MYSQL_PASSWORD:${KC_DB_PASSWORD}
MYSQL_ROOT_PASSWORD=${KC_DB_PASSWORD}
# MySQL Root Credentials (Optional, if needed for root access)
DB_ROOT_PASSWORD=rootpassword
# Keycloak Startup Options
KEYCLOAK_START_OPTIONS=--spi-theme-welcome-theme=waverifypluss